Folios 272-273: Robert O'Brien, Regulating Captain, Limerick. Acknowledges receipt of Admiralty letter of 25 July enclosing copy of one of 13th from Lieutenant Lea of the Signal Station on Great Blasket Islands complaining of conduct of four boatmen in that neighbourhood. Also instructions for him to go there and endeavour to impress those man and any others. On arrival of the Landrail from Cork gave orders for her to proceed to Plymouth. Has now carried out all instructions. Takes the opportunity to state the excellent conduct of Lieutenant Haswell commanding the Landrail.
